Turn your Palm TX into an iTunes remote
Let's say you find yourself with a brand new Palm T|X and you'd like a way to control your Mac remotely (I'm looking at you, Dave). Why not use your new WiFi enabled Palm and VNC to do just that?Working in conjunction with AirTunes, the Idealong did just that and it works like a charm. He also tried using webRemote, but the VNC solution is a little faster.
Now, I'm not saying this is some sort of super high tech solution, but it is useful and easily implemented, so if you can't wait for Front Row to run on a Mac mini give this is shot.
